Room temperature broadband polariton lasing from a dye‐filled microcavity
A material system is proposed to generate polariton lasing at room temperature over a broad spectral range. The system developed is based on a boron‐dipyrromethene fluorescent dye (BODIPY‐G1) that is dispersed into a polystyrene matrix and used as the active layer of a strongly coupled microcavity. It is shown that the BODIPY‐G1 exciton polaritons undergo nonlinear emission over a broad range of exciton–cavity mode detuning in the green‐yellow portion of the visible spectrum, with polariton lasing achieved over a spectral range spanning 33 nm. The recorded linewidth of ≈0.1 nm corresponds to a condensate coherence lifetime of ≈1 ps. It is proposed that similar effects can be anticipated using a range of molecular dyes in the BODIPY family; a result that paves the way for tunable polariton devices over the visible and near‐infrared spectral region
Analisis Kepuasan Pengguna E-Learning pada Universitas Pembangunan Nasional Veteran Jawa Timur Menggunakan Model Kano
E-learning is a distance learning method without having to meet face to face. Because in conventional learning there are often problems with limited time, distance, and costs, particurally due to the current pandemic. UPN Veteran Jawa Timur has implemented the e-learning information system in teaching and learning activities. The involvement of users in accessing the web utilizing information system technology will determine the success of the quality of the system and information applied. The researcher conducted a literature study related to the research. Among them are E-learning, Kano Model, and quantitative research methods. Respondent data were collected using the "Simple Random Sampling" method. Data collection was carried out in this study by indirectly distributing questionnaires. The attributes of the questionnaire were identified using the Kano method to determine the level of user satisfaction with the E-learning system at UPN Veteran Jawa Timur. In this research questionnaire, there are 29 attribute questions with the results of 7 attributes that according to respondents are satisfactory, and 14 attributes according to respondents including dissatisfaction. It was found that the one-dimensional category was still included in the dissatisfaction quadrant where this category greatly influenced user satisfaction. The suggestions that the author can suggest are to pay attention to the attributes that fall into the one-dimensional and must-be categories, especially for the high value of dissatisfaction. For a high satisfaction value, the author suggests that it should be maintained, and it is better if these attributes are developed by paying attention to user satisfaction

Kata kunci: kaltim, kritik sosial, koran, cerpen Abstract This study presents a picture of social criticism in three short stories published in newspapers in East Kalimantan in the 1980s, namely "Nomer", "Suatu Sore di Pinggiran Desa", and "Tatkala Takbir Menggema". Social phenomena in the society in those short stories are worth disclosing. It is necessary to see the social conditions in the society in the 1980s. It can be considered to be the beginning of literary works in the form of short stories in print media of newspapers in East Kalimantan. The author uses qualitative methods to reveal the social picture in the 1980s in East Kalimantan. It also uses the sociological approaches to literature to show social problems in these three short stories. However, as a starting point, the writer will use the structure to reveal one of the intrinsic elements in the short stories. Social problems in those short stories are poverty, disorganization in the family, family disorganization, young people in modern society, violations of social norms, demography, environment, and bureaucracy. Keywords: East Kalimantan, social criticism, newspaper, short stories
Efficient light harvesting in hybrid quantum dot-interdigitated back contact solar cells via resonant energy transfer and luminescent downshifting
In this paper, we propose a hybrid quantum dot (QD)/solar cell configuration to improve performance of interdigitated back contact (IBC) silicon solar cells, resulting in 39.5% relative boost in the short-circuit current (JSC) through efficient utilisation of resonant energy transfer (RET) and luminescent downshifting (LDS). A uniform layer of CdSe1−xSx/ZnS quantum dots is deposited onto the AlOx surface passivation layer of the IBC solar cell. QD hybridization is found to cause a broadband improvement in the solar cell external quantum efficiency. Enhancement over the QD absorption wavelength range is shown to result from LDS. This is confirmed by significant boosts in the solar cell internal quantum efficiency (IQE) due to the presence of QDs. Enhancement over the red and near-infrared spectral range is shown to result from the anti-reflection properties of the QD layer coating. A study on the effect of QD layer thickness on solar cell performance was performed and an optimised QD layer thickness was determined. Time-resolved photoluminescence (TRPL) spectroscopy was used to investigate the photoluminescence dynamics of the QD layer as a function of AlOx spacer layer thickness. RET can be evoked between the QD and Si layers for very thin AlOx spacer layers, with RET efficiencies of up to 15%. In the conventional LDS architecture, down-converters are deposited on the surface of an optimised anti-reflection layer, providing relatively narrowband enhancement, whereas the QDs in our hybrid architecture provide optical enhancement over the broadband wavelength range, by simultaneously utilising LDS, RET-mediated carrier injection, and antireflection effects, resulting in up to 40% improvement in the power conversion efficiency (PCE). Low-cost synthesis of QDs and simple device integration provide a cost-effective solution for boosting solar cell performance
VALUES OF A. GAIDAR’S HEROES (“TIMUR AND HIS TEAM”)
The purpose of the article is to show values of A. Gaidar’s heroes as a system and prove that its
roots can be found in pre-revolutionary culture. Such approach helps to disclose deep connection of author’s
works with Russian classical literature. The novel “Timur and his team” became the object for analysis as it
has seriously influenced behavioral strategies of teens. The analysis of the work in the aspect of axiology
helps to overcome ideological approach to estimating Gaidar’s art. Such guidelines as living in team, doing
good things, saving world from injustice, labour as happiness are pointed out. Special accent is made on
depicting episodes of Timur’s team help to the inhabitants of the village, the structure of such episodes is
carefully studied. It is shown that help is being planned as a military operation, which results in actions
being coordinated and swift, also pointed out methods, which helped Gaidar achieve dynamism, swiftness
in these episodes: lack of detailed descriptions, the predominance of verbs, a vivid comparison, a curious ending. As a result work is
presented not as exhausting, but hard and joyful occupation. Also several principles of creating Timur’s team members are characterised: the author uses telling surnames, gives his heroes a stable portrait feature, a special manner of speech. The main conclusion of the
article is that Gaidar finds the origins of new soviet culture in old, pre-revolutionary culture, that’s why in his novel a lot of references
to key works of Russian literature (e.g. to Gogol’s “Taras Bulba”, Pushkin’s “Capitain’s Daughter”) and art (Repin’s painting “Cossaks
of Zaporozhye write a letter to the Turkish sultan) can be found, the usage of symbolic character images (ravine, garden, chapel with
the pictures of hell) is marked. Gaidar brings back traditional values, which were abandoned in the era of revolutionary reorganisation
of society, but fills them with new, actual for his time ideas. The conclusions of the article may be used in the practise of teaching in
schools and universities
